Abstract: Technologies for securely extending cloud service application programming interfaces (APIs) in a cloud service marketplace include a connector hub of a marketplace computing device communicatively coupled to a cloud service provider interface of a cloud service provider and a cloud service broker interface of a cloud service broker. The connector hub is configured to deploy an API connector instance in a connection factory of the marketplace computing device, transmit provider provisioning channel credentials to the API connector instance and the cloud service provider interface and transmit broker provisioning channel credentials to the API connector instance and the cloud service broker interface. The connector hub is additionally configured establish a provisioning channel between the cloud service provider interface and the cloud service broker interface. Additional embodiments are described herein.
Type:
Grant
Filed:
April 15, 2022
Date of Patent:
January 21, 2025
Assignee:
CloudBlue LLC
Inventors:
Maxim Kuzkin, Aleksandr Khaerov, Vladimir Zatsepin, Vladimir Grebenschikov
Abstract: Technologies for creating and distributing integration connectors in cloud service brokerage systems include a developer portal computing device communicatively coupled to a connector hub of a marketplace computing. The developer portal computing device is configured to receive information from a developer via a developer UI portal of a developer portal computing device. Such information includes connector descriptor information for a connector associated with a cloud service and one or more resource types of the connector.
Type:
Grant
Filed:
June 1, 2020
Date of Patent:
September 5, 2023
Assignee:
CloudBlue LLC
Inventors:
Vladimir Grebenshikov, Maxim Kuzkin, Alexander Khaerov
Abstract: A graphical user interface (GUI) (or a user navigation interface), is a common feature of computer systems and application well known to one having ordinary skill in the arts. In cloud service broker (CSB) environments, GUI rendering is more complicated because independent software vendors (ISV) distribute cloud applications (cloud services) through CSBs and allow different cloud applications to collaborate through standardized representational state transfer (RESTful) application program interfaces (API). If there are multiple applications that are integrated, the GUI may include numerous interfaces specifically tailored to the each of the specific applications. However, preparing all combinations of screens requires extensive development, which increases as more and more applications are integrated.
Abstract: The present disclosure relates to a system and method of digital product onboarding and distribution using a cloud service brokerage (CSB) infrastructure, whereby the method includes creating a product model at a vendor portal computing device, the product model based at least in part on a first product, storing the product model at a marketplace product catalog, exporting the product model to a third-party CSB platform, exporting the product model to an ordering system, configuring an application programming interface (API) to receive a request for integration of the first product, receiving, at the order system, the request for the first product, wherein the request includes a request product model payload, and fulfilling, at the order system, the request for the first product, based at least in part on a product attribute.
Type:
Grant
Filed:
December 28, 2018
Date of Patent:
December 27, 2022
Assignee:
CloudBlue LLC
Inventors:
Marc Serrat Bote, Sr., Maxim Kuzkin, Vladimir Grebenschikov, David Wippich
Abstract: The invention proposes a simpler and more efficient method for building a navigation schema in a cloud service broker platform (CSB) that builds a complex user interface (UI) from the CSB platform to an integrated connector application. The present disclosure automates navigation schema generation by obtaining a connector package, transforming a navigation schema therein from a hierarchical form to a plain form, and creating a modified schema for such. The present disclosure further discloses a method for creating a navigation schema template according to chosen placeholders and helps a user to fill in the template, and further check the created schema.
Abstract: Systems and methods for allowing one or more users to access a number of tenant systems in a multi-tenant cloud environment are disclosed. The method includes registering a user to the tenant systems based on an identity information received from the user. The same identity information is associated with each of the tenant systems. The method also includes creating an account corresponding to each of the tenant systems for the user. The method further includes allowing the user to access one or more of the tenant systems based on the identity information entered by the user. The user accesses the tenant systems by entering the same identity information. Further, the same identity information is used for identifying the user in each of the tenant systems.
Type:
Grant
Filed:
March 4, 2019
Date of Patent:
January 11, 2022
Assignee:
CloudBlue LLC
Inventors:
Swarup Das, David Hou Chang, David Wippich